About

Founded in Taiwan in 1965, SWAN develops and manufactures footwear for children, including first-walker shoes, casual styles, sneakers, functional shoes, sandals and Mary Janes. Its designs are based on children’s foot development, with shaped lasts intended to follow the foot and materials selected for breathability and support. Practical details include hook-and-loop straps, laces and slip-resistant soles for active wear. The range also includes playful accents such as bows, flowers, teddy bears and stars. Products are made in Taiwan, drawing on more than half a century of shoemaking experience.
